France Work Permit: Your Guide to Employment in France
Non-EU citizens need a France work permit to work legally. Common permits include the Talent Passport for skilled workers and the Long-Term Visa for employment purposes. Applicants must provide a job offer, employment contract, proof of qualifications, passport, and health insurance. Processing times can vary, so apply well in advance.

What is Work Permit?
A work permit is an official document issued by a country’s government that allows foreign nationals to work legally within that country.
It grants the holder the right to be employed in a specific job and typically outlines the conditions of employment, including the job role, duration of stay, and the employer's details.
Document Checklist for France Work Permit from UAE
Valid Passport (at least 6 months validity)
Completed Work Permit Application Form
Job Offer or Employment Contract from a French employer
Proof of Qualifications (educational certificates and diplomas)
Curriculum Vitae (CV) and work experience details
Health Insurance Coverage for the duration of stay
Proof of Financial Means (bank statements)
Passport-Sized Photographs (as per embassy specifications)
Police Clearance Certificate from UAE
UAE Residence Permit (if applicable)
